Permitted Indebtedness. Means (i) Indebtedness evidenced by this Note; (ii) debt incurred to make acquisitions; (iii) trade payables incurred in the ordinary course of business consistent with past practice, (iv) unsecured indebtedness not in excess of $100,000 in the aggregate, and (v) Indebtedness secured by Permitted Liens.
